Texas Tech University is a company that provides Law library, Medical school, Cement and more. Texas Tech University is headquartered in United States Texas. Texas Tech University was founded in 1923. Texas Tech University has a total of 279 patents and 41,856 literature
Texas Tech University was created by legislative action in 1923 and has the distinction of being the largest comprehensive higher education institution...